Transaction c156be440c758cdd49592030fd378e234d65aace72803cae0a18f757cdc042f4
1 Input
1 Output
-
c156be440c758cdd49592030fd378e234d65aace72803cae0a18f757cdc042f4:0
- value
- 21610572
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4af00e3c024b56fbd767633c3cc96a7292b1be8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MrAiC8m5wB6gvt5EpbbcE62BfAHaDSsWP